Struct ErrorScopeGuard

Source
pub struct ErrorScopeGuard {
    device: DispatchDevice,
    index: u32,
    popped: bool,
    _phantom: PhantomData<*mut ()>,
}
Expand description

Guard for an error scope pushed with Device::push_error_scope().

Call pop() to pop the scope and get a future for the result. If the guard is dropped without being popped explicitly, the scope will still be popped, and the captured errors will be dropped.

This guard is neither Send nor Sync, as error scopes are handled on a per-thread basis when the std feature is enabled.

impl ErrorScopeGuard

Source

pub fn pop(self) -> impl Future<Output = Option<Error>> + WasmNotSend

Pops the error scope.

Returns a future which resolves to the error captured by this scope, if any. The pop takes effect immediately; the future does not need to be awaited before doing work that is outside of this error scope.
